Latest Patents

Nanayakkara holds a patent titled "Method for forming structures including transition metal layers." This patent reveals methods that allow for the formation of transition metal layers on a substrate's surface, highlighting the effectiveness of a transition layer for facilitating the deposition of transition metal layers, especially on high aspect ratio features. This innovative approach additionally aims to mitigate bending issues during the deposition processes.
